A member asked:

Some pain in the ear, and lots of new, painless jaw popping, or what seems like misalignment. no injuries but my bite seems off. what is this?

Dr. Paul Grin answered

Specializes in Pain Management

Classic TMJ: When your jaw joints are misaligned or not working properly, the resulting popping and locking and discomfort can extend far past your jaw and ear pain. See a dentist or TMJ specialist for examination, diagnosis and treatment.
